This is frustrating. I'm trying to create a posting for the classifieds. I do what I always do, compose it (in HTML) in MS-Word, then cut and paste into the SMC editor. Everything looks right when I do that, but when I hit 'Preview Post', all the returns are stripped out - not just in the preview, but in the editor too. It also happens if I just type text into the editor, so it's nothing that MS-Word is doing. Help!

As you can now see (notice the blank line after the last paragraph) I've found the issue. It's the Safari browser, latest update must have broken it. When I use IE everything is peachy. Oh well. Thanks for the suggestions. Good idea on CTRL-Enter, but that has no effect.
